Welcome to the CNZ SI Golf Croquet Competition. Some information for you:
The lawns will be available on Wednesday 21 February 2024 from 4pm-6pm if you would like to come and have a practice.
The Tournament will be opened by the Mayor, or a representative from Ashburton District Council at 8am on Thursday. This will be followed by housekeeping information and the information you require for the Doubles.
All games (doubles and singles) will commence at 8.30am, a 5 minute ‘hit up allowed’ each morning prior to the start of the games.
Doubles:
Thursday each doubles team will play 2 rounds against four opponents, a total of 8 x 13 point games.
Friday each team will play 1 further round of two games against their 5th opponent. When this round is complete there will be a normal round robin of one further game against each opponent. A total of 7 x 13 point games on day 2. The winner will be determined as per Tournament Regulation 20.7.8 for multi-game matches. However, in the event of significant delay to the event, alternative completion options may be used.
There will be no double banking for the doubles play.
Singles:
Saturday and Sunday:
Play will commence with two blocks of 8 playing 13 point single games. The top 4 from each block will qualify for the Main KO. The non-qualifiers will enter a 7 round Consolation event.
The KOs will be BO3 with a YKO for QF losers and a 3/4 play-off for the Main KO SF losers. The YKO SF losers will play a ZKO final.
The first four rounds of the Consolation draw will see players from prelim Block A playing opponents from prelim Block B.
To assist an earlier finish for the tournament on Sunday afternoon, we may play the first games of the KO and the Consolation event on Saturday afternoon.
Double banking will be required.
No time limits will be set; however, as Manager, I reserve the right to set a time limit if a match is holding up a round. The time limit will be according to the GC Rules.
